Creamy Crockpot Cowboy Soup in a bowl

Creamy Crockpot Cowboy Soup: Easy, Hearty, and Flavorful

By:

Jessica

|

October 29, 2025

Last Updated

|

October 29, 2025

Creamy Crockpot Cowboy Soup is the ultimate comfort dish for busy weeknights when you crave something hearty, flavorful, and soul-warming. Imagine coming home after a long day, the house filled with the rich aroma of beef, beans, and slow-simmered spices—it’s like a warm Texas hug in a bowl.

This Creamy Crockpot Cowboy Soup brings together the best of the West: tender ground beef, rustic potatoes, a mix of veggies, and that slow-cooked creamy broth that makes everyone ask for seconds. The best part? It practically cooks itself while you handle life’s chaos—because dinner shouldn’t feel like a rodeo every night.

Table of Contents

What is Creamy Crockpot Cowboy Soup?

Creamy Crockpot Cowboy Soup is a homestyle soup that’s as comforting as a campfire under the stars. It’s packed with ground beef, beans, potatoes, and veggies, simmered in a slow cooker until every bite bursts with rich, savory flavor. Think of it as chili’s cozier cousin—less spicy, more creamy, and perfectly hearty. The “cowboy” part comes from its simple, down-to-earth ingredients—nothing fancy, just good old-fashioned flavor.

Whether you’re feeding a crowd, prepping for a lazy Sunday, or needing a meal that warms you from the inside out, this recipe delivers. It’s the kind of soup that feels like a reward after a long day and pairs perfectly with a slice of cornbread or a sprinkle of cheese on top.

Reasons to Try Creamy Crockpot Cowboy Soup

There’s something special about this Creamy Crockpot Cowboy Soup—it’s comfort food without the fuss. First, it’s ridiculously easy to make. Toss everything in the slow cooker and let it do the work while you conquer your day. Second, it’s family-friendly; even the pickiest eaters love it because it’s flavorful without being too spicy. Third, it’s a make-once, eat-twice kind of meal—it tastes even better the next day.

Plus, it’s budget-friendly and freezer-friendly, which means less food waste and more happy tummies. If you’re a fan of cozy, creamy soups like Creamy Marry Me Chicken Soup or crave hearty one-pot wonders like Cowboy Cornbread Casserole, this one will slide right into your favorites list.

Ingredients Needed to Make Creamy Crockpot Cowboy Soup

  • 1 lb ground beef
  • 1 small yellow onion, chopped
  • 2 cloves garlic, minced
  • 1 russet potato, diced (peeled or not, your call)
  • 1 cup frozen corn
  • 2 cups mixed frozen vegetables (peas, carrots, green beans, corn)
  • 1 can (15 oz) pinto beans, drained and rinsed
  • 1 can (15 oz) black beans, drained and rinsed
  • 1 can (15 oz) diced tomatoes (with juices)
  • 1 can (15 oz) tomato sauce
  • 5–6 cups beef broth
  • 1 tsp chili powder
  • 1 tsp paprika
  • 1 tsp cumin
  • Salt and black pepper to taste
  • Fresh parsley for garnish (optional)
Creamy Crockpot Cowboy Soup ingredients on table
Fresh ingredients for Creamy Crockpot Cowboy Soup

Instructions to Make Creamy Crockpot Cowboy Soup

This Creamy Crockpot Cowboy Soup Step by Step guide will walk you through each part of the cooking process—so even if you’re juggling a busy day, you’ll have a delicious, hearty dinner ready without breaking a sweat. Grab your slow cooker, take a deep breath, and let’s make some magic in your kitchen!

Step 1: Brown the Beef for Rich Flavor

Start your Creamy Crockpot Cowboy Soup Step by Step journey by heating a large skillet over medium heat. Add your ground beef and break it apart using a wooden spoon. Cook until the beef turns brown and no longer pink, about 5 to 7 minutes. This step builds a rich, savory base that gives your soup depth. If your beef releases excess grease, go ahead and drain it—no one wants an oily soup!

For an extra boost of flavor, sprinkle in a pinch of your chili powder or paprika while browning. This helps bloom the spices early and gives your beef that irresistible smoky aroma. If you’re looking for a lighter option, you can easily swap the beef for ground turkey—similar to how it’s done in our Ground Turkey Sweet Potatoes recipe.

Step 2: Prep the Crockpot and Build the Base

Once your beef is ready, lightly coat the inside of your slow cooker with cooking spray or a drizzle of oil. This small but mighty Step by Step move helps prevent sticking and makes cleanup a breeze (and trust me, we’re all about easy cleanups here).
Next, toss in your chopped onion and minced garlic. These aromatics are the heart of flavor in this dish—they’ll slowly release sweetness as the soup cooks. Think of them as the background singers that make the star (your beef) shine even brighter.

Step 3: Add the Veggies, Beans, and Broth

Here comes the fun part of this Creamy Crockpot Cowboy Soup Step by Step process—layering all those hearty ingredients! Add your browned beef to the slow cooker, followed by the diced potatoes, frozen corn, and mixed vegetables. Then, pour in your pinto beans, black beans, diced tomatoes (with their juices), and tomato sauce.

Sprinkle in your chili powder, paprika, cumin, salt, and pepper. Now, pour in enough beef broth to just cover the ingredients (usually about 6 cups). Give everything a good stir to mix all that color and texture together. The mixture should look thick and cozy already—like a promise of good things to come.
For inspiration on other hearty soups packed with veggies and beans, check out our Flavorful Quinoa Vegetable Soup for another comforting bowl full of nutrients and flavor.

Step 4: Set It and Forget It (Almost!)

Now that your ingredients are in the crockpot, cover it with the lid and cook on low for 6–8 hours or high for 3–4 hours. This Step by Step cooking process allows all the flavors to meld beautifully, giving you that slow-simmered taste with minimal effort.
As it cooks, your kitchen will fill with the mouthwatering aroma of beef, spices, and veggies. You’ll know it’s ready when the potatoes are fork-tender, and the broth has thickened slightly. If you’re home, give it a quick stir halfway through to make sure everything cooks evenly.

Step 5: Adjust the Texture and Taste

When the cooking time is up, it’s time for the final Step by Step finishing touch. Taste your soup and adjust the seasoning if needed—add a bit more salt or pepper, or even a dash of hot sauce if you like a little heat.
If you prefer a thicker, creamier soup, scoop out about one cup of the mixture and carefully blend it in a blender or with an immersion blender. Then, pour it back into the slow cooker and stir. This trick (which you can also use in recipes like our Creamy Vegan Potato Soup) makes your soup luxuriously thick without needing cream.

Step 6: Garnish and Serve

Finally, ladle your Creamy Crockpot Cowboy Soup into bowls and top with a sprinkle of chopped fresh parsley. If you want to make it extra indulgent, add a dollop of sour cream or a sprinkle of shredded cheddar cheese. Serve it with a slice of crusty bread or a side of Jiffy Corn Casserole for that perfect cowboy-style meal.
This Step by Step cooking guide leaves you with a bowl of warm, flavorful comfort food that’s ideal for weeknights or family gatherings. It’s simple, satisfying, and a total crowd-pleaser—proof that great things really do come from the slow cooker.

What to Serve with Creamy Crockpot Cowboy Soup

This soup is hearty enough to stand on its own, but if you want to take it up a notch, serve it with warm crusty bread or cornbread for dipping. A side of Paula Deen Corn Casserole or a crisp green salad makes a great companion.

If you’re planning a cozy weekend dinner, you can pair it with something slightly sweet like Sweet Potato Casserole with Pecan for that sweet-and-savory harmony that feels like a hug on a plate.

Key Tips for Making Creamy Crockpot Cowboy Soup

  • Brown the beef first for that rich, caramelized flavor.
  • Use a slow cooker liner for the easiest cleanup ever.
  • If you want it creamier, stir in a splash of heavy cream or half-and-half near the end of cooking.
  • To make it spicier, add a pinch of cayenne or a few dashes of hot sauce.
  • Want more thickness? Puree a cup of the soup and mix it back in—it’s a game changer.
  • Like to meal prep? This soup freezes beautifully and reheats like a dream.

Storage and Reheating Tips for Creamy Crockpot Cowboy Soup

Let your soup cool completely before storing. Keep leftovers in an airtight container in the fridge for up to 4 days, or freeze for up to 3 months. To reheat, warm it on the stove over medium heat or microwave it in a covered bowl until steaming hot. If it’s too thick, just add a splash of broth or water. The flavor actually deepens after a day, making it perfect for make-ahead lunches or lazy night dinners.

FAQs

Can I use ground turkey instead of beef? Absolutely! It’ll be lighter but still delicious.
How can I make it vegetarian? Swap the beef for lentils or a plant-based meat alternative and use vegetable broth.
Can I make it on the stovetop? Sure! Just simmer everything in a large pot for about 45 minutes, stirring occasionally.
What if I don’t have all the veggies? Use whatever’s in your freezer—this soup is forgiving and flexible.

Final Thoughts

When life gets busy and you crave something cozy and filling, Creamy Crockpot Cowboy Soup is your trusty go-to. It’s hearty, easy, and guaranteed to make everyone at the table happy (even the picky ones). Whether you’re meal prepping, feeding a crowd, or just need a quick win for dinner, this soup delivers comfort by the spoonful. For more cozy soup ideas, check out One-Pot Creamy Chicken Enchilada Soup or Crock Pot Thai Ginger Chicken Soup next—you’ll thank me later.

Follow us on Pinterest for weekly slow cooker inspiration, or join the conversation over on our Facebook page where fellow food lovers share their favorite comfort meal.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Creamy Crockpot Cowboy Soup in a bowl

Creamy Crockpot Cowboy Soup: Easy, Hearty, and Flavorful

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Jessica
  • Prep Time: 15 minutes
  • Cook Time: 8 minutes
  • Total Time: 23 minutes
  • Yield: 8 servings
  • Category: Soup
  • Method: Slow Cooker
  • Cuisine: American

Description

This Crockpot Cowboy Soup is the perfect satisfying soup recipe. It’s easy to make and is a flavorful and comforting dish that keeps you coming back for more.


Ingredients

  • 1 pound ground beef
  • 1 small yellow onion, chopped
  • 2 cloves garlic, minced
  • 1 russet potato, diced (skin on or peeled)
  • 1 cup frozen corn
  • 2 cups mixed frozen vegetables (peas, carrots, green beans, corn)
  • 1 can (15 oz) pinto beans, drained and rinsed
  • 1 can (15 oz) black beans, drained and rinsed
  • 1 can (15 oz) diced tomatoes (with juices)
  • 1 can (15 oz) tomato sauce
  • 56 cups beef broth
  • 1 teaspoon chili powder
  • 1 teaspoon paprika
  • 1 teaspoon cumin
  • Salt to taste
  • Black pepper to taste
  • Fresh parsley for garnish (optional)


Instructions

1. In a skillet over medium heat, cook the ground beef until browned, breaking it up as it cooks. Drain excess grease if needed.

2. Coat the inside of your slow cooker with a light layer of cooking spray or oil.

3. Place the chopped onion and minced garlic in the slow cooker.

4. Add the browned beef, diced potato, corn, mixed vegetables, pinto beans, black beans, diced tomatoes, tomato sauce, seasonings, and beef broth. Adjust broth to slightly cover the ingredients (about 6 cups).

5. Mix everything until combined.

6. Cover and cook on low for 6–8 hours or high for 3–4 hours, until the potatoes and vegetables are tender.

7. Taste and adjust seasoning if needed. Serve hot, garnished with chopped fresh parsley if desired.


Notes

For a thicker soup, blend a portion of the potatoes before serving.

Always brown the beef beforehand to prevent greasiness and ensure full cooking.

Use a slow cooker liner for easier cleanup.

This recipe stores well and is great for meal prep.

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star